Abstract We present an analysis of high resolution spectra in the far-UV – UV range (∼905–2000Å) with non-LTE, spherical, hydrodynamical, line-blanketed models, of three O-type Galactic stars, and derive their photospheric and wind parameters. These data extend previously analyzed samples and fill a gap in spectral type coverage. The combined sample confirms a revised (downward) T eff scale with respect to canonical calibrations, as found in our previous works from UV and optical spectra, and in recent works by other authors.
